Grigor,

 

I get the same problem from time to time.  I am not sure if it just how freelancing is or not, but I have found ways that do get me better conversions.  Here are my tips that improved my conversions for my profile.

 

1.  I completed my profile.

2.  Added in any certificates and accomplishments with scanned copies

3. I added in content showcasing what I completed in my previous projects with a video.

4. I added an introduction video to my profile.

5. I structure my proposal as follows:

    a. Intro with a project or projects I have completed similar to this one.

    b.  I explain my background in two to three sentences

c. I summarize their project needs to indicate I know what they need.

    d.  I create an outline of how I will accomplish the project.

    e.  I ask for a phone call to go over any questions they may have about me and the project

    f,  I thank them for reading my proposal

6. And lastly, I add some extra value content explaining my services in a brochure and infographics.

 

After I changed to this I was able to get more conversions on projects.  I also focused on projects I know I could complete.

 

You could try something like this, as it might help get you a couple more jobs a month.

First of all, it does take time to get started on Upwork - and you did get some jobs in June. Be patient. However, in your profile, I suggest you focus on what you can do for clients and say less about yourself. The first two sentences of your profile overview are crucial for what you offer clients. Many clients won't get beyond those sentences if you don't "get" to them.
